Jason deCaires Taylor uses Sigma lenses to photograph his work, raise awareness about threatened coral reefs Ronkonkoma, N.Y., Dec. 13, 2011 – Sigma Corporation of America has teamed up with underwater photographer, sculptor and conservationist Jason deCaires Taylor to help photograph the artist’s oft-unseen work and share it with the world. Taylor is the mastermind behind the underwater sculpture park, known as the Museo Subacuático de Arte (MUSA) in Cancun, Mexico.
